Perfect Half Manhwa explores a range of themes that resonate with readers of all ages. One of the primary themes is self-acceptance and self-love. Min-Soo's journey is a metaphor for the struggles we all face in accepting ourselves for who we are. His experiences serve as a reminder that our flaws and imperfections are what make us unique and beautiful.

One of the standout aspects of Perfect Half Manhwa is its well-developed characters. Min-Soo, the protagonist, is a complex and relatable character whose struggles with his identity and self-acceptance resonate deeply with readers. Perfect Half Manhwa, also known as "The Perfect Half," is a South Korean webtoon created by writer Jae-Ho Cho and artist Geuk-Jin. The webtoon was first published in 2019 and has since become one of the most popular and highly-rated webtoons on various platforms, including Tapas, Webtoons, and Lezhin. The art style of Perfect Half Manhwa is a perfect complement to its engaging story and characters. Geuk-Jin's illustrations are detailed and expressive, bringing the characters and world to life. The webtoon's use of color is also noteworthy, with a palette that shifts from light and bright to dark and muted, reflecting the mood and tone of each scene.
